- An introduction to Judaism as text-centered traditions and conceptions of law, along with an outline of the Jewish legal history, is given as frame for a more specific presentation of the history of the Jews in the Nordic societies up to modern times with Denmark as the main example, including potential problems such as ritual slaughter and circumcision. The close relationship between Jewish law and ethics, and human rights, is discussed, supplemented with a perspective on the contemporary condition of Jews as a minority coping with problems of identity and assimilation.
